Strata Skin Sciences Company Profile
Strata Skin Sciences, Inc is a medical technology company headquartered in Edison, New Jersey, that specializes in developing and commercializing dermatological devices and therapies. The company’s flagship offering is the XTRAC® excimer laser system, an FDA‐cleared, 308-nanometer ultraviolet light device used to treat skin conditions such as vitiligo and psoriasis. Strata’s product suite also includes associated accessories and disposables, as well as clinical services and training programs designed to support dermatology practices and improve patient outcomes.
Strata Skin Sciences expanded its portfolio and market presence through the strategic acquisition of PhotoMedex in 2019, bringing together complementary phototherapy and energy-based technologies under one roof.
